About

Classical musician who was known for her mastery of Romantic-era composers, especially of their smaller compositions.

Before Fame

She was a student at the Royal Academy of Music under famed Teacher and musician Tobias Matthay.

Trivia

She was acclaimed for her refined technique and control, as well as her selflessness in performing pieces allowing the compositions to speak for themselves.

Family Life

She shared a great-great-grandfather with fellow Pianist Harriet Cohen.

Associated With

Her last concert appearance was a performance of Mozart's Sonata for Two Pianos with frequent collaborator Myra Hess.
